NFL games are known for being back and forth encounters where teams one up each other on the scoreboard in search of victory. However, there have been times when both teams struggle to reach the endzone, resulting in low scoring games, or even no scoring. As per Pro Football Reference, 73 games in pro football history have ended in a 0-0 tie. However, the last time that took place was almost 80 years ago, meaning there's been no scoreless ties in the Super Bowl era.

When was the last 0-0 tie in the NFL?

The most recent 0-0 tie took place on November 7, 1943 when the Detroit Lions hosted the New York Giants at Briggs Stadium. With the game taking place in the middle of World War II, many NFL players were overseas after being drafted. As a result, the two teams played with diminished rosters, and the scoreline was proof of that. The fact that it rained and field conditions were subpar didn't help matters, as fields didn't have the sophisticated drainage systems that are now taken for granted. As a result, the rain created problems for both teams, with mud slowing them down at every turn. In total the two teams combined for just nine first downs and 214 yards, which isn't all that surprising considering the game featured 77 running plays and 16 pass attempts. Back then the single-wing offence was dominant, meaning scoreless ties were an all too common occurrence. One the T-formation took over in the 1940s, scoring increased as teams found the end zone with more regularity. Even the kicking game struggled due to the poor conditions. Lions kicker Augie Lio missed three field goals from distances of 32, 40 and 15 yards. Giants kicker Ward Cuff also missed his lone attempt. No overtime was played as the NFL wouldn't introduce the additional period for another three decades.

Can Liverpool win the quadruple?

Yes! Liverpool may be keen to dismiss all mention of it but (whisper it) the quadruple is still on. The Reds already have two trophies this season having lifted the League Cup on 27 February and the FA Cup on 14 May, defeating Chelsea on penalties on both occasions. Their battle with Manchester City for the Premier League title, meanwhile, will go to the final day on 22 May, six days before the UEFA Champions League final.

Has a team ever won the quadruple before?

1967 final highlights: Celtic's Lisbon Lions

Celtic's Lisbon Lions – in 1966/67 – are the only team to date to have lifted a quadruple of European Cup, domestic league, domestic cup and domestic league cup in the same season. League Cups are played in a minority of countries, including England, Portugal and France, although the latter competition has not taken place since 2019/20. Liverpool won a quadruple of sorts in 2000/01, albeit with the UEFA Cup.

Has an English team ever won the treble?

Manchester United are the only English team to date to win the treble of European Cup, domestic league and domestic cup, in 1998/99. The closest Liverpool have come to the treble was in 1976/77, when they won the league and their first European Cup either side of losing the FA Cup final 2-1 to – you guessed it – Manchester United. United fell short of a quadruple, though, exiting the League Cup at the quarter-final stage.

Which teams have won the treble?

1966/67: Celtic*

1971/72: Ajax

1987/88: PSV Eindhoven

1998/99: Manchester United

2008/09: Barcelona

2009/10: Inter

2012/13: Bayern München

2014/15: Barcelona

2019/20: Bayern München

* Also won Scottish League Cup
